Abstract

The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between body image and self-esteem among college going girls using correlation design. A random sample of 250 students all of them belonging to Allahabad University completed a set of questionnaire of Rosenberg self-esteem questionnaire and body shape questionnaire result indicates that fashion or beauty magazines, social comparisons, overall appearance are important predictors of body image and self-esteem in adolescent college going girls and body image was confirmed to significantly related to self esteem which supported the hypothesis.
